Measuring a Pulse in the Time Domain

The following example shows a triggered measurement of a pulsed 1 GHz signal in zero-span mode:

1.Preset the analyzer using the Preset button.

2.On the analyzer, set up the following: Center Frequency: 1 GHz

Span: 0 Hz

Reference Level: 10 dBm

3.On the Bandwidth menu, set the sweep time to be twice the pulse width of the signal. In this case, it is set to 0.2 ms to measure a 0.1 ms pulse width.

4.On the Trigger menu, set the trigger source to Video, enter a trigger level of –20 dBm, and ensure that Rising edge triggering is selected.

The display should look like the one in the figure below:
